#bf59b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f59b9 is composed of 74.9% red, 34.9%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 3.1%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 303.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#bf59b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#7f0073.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#bf59b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f59b9 has RGB values of R:191, G:89,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.03,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12540345.

Shades and Tints of #bf59b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f59b9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938592 is the less saturated color, while #fd1bf0 is the most saturated one.
